Frequently Asked Questions

1 What is a Microscope Camera?

A Microscope Camera is a specialized camera designed to capture images or video through the lens of a microscope.

2 How does a Microscope Camera work?

It captures images or video from the lens of microscope and displays them on a screen or computer for analysis.

3 What is the difference between a Digital Microscope and a Microscope Camera?

A Digital Microscope has a built-in camera and display whereas a Microscope Camera attaches to an existing microscope to capture and display images.

4 Can Microscope Camera be used for both live and still images?

It is used to capture both live and still images.

5 Is Microscope Camera compatible with all types of Microscopes?

It is compatible with various types of Microscopes including Light, Stereo and Digital Microscopes.

6 Can Microscope Camera be used for both biological and material science samples?

It is widely used for both biological and material science samples.

7 How is calibration done in case of Microscope Camera?

It is done using a calibration slide or known measurement standards in order to ensure accurate measurements.

8 What is the role of the adapter in a Microscope Camera?

It is used to connect the camera to the microscope in order to ensure proper alignment and a stable connection for image capture.

9 Is Microscope Camera suitable for industrial or quality control applications?

It is widely used in industrial and quality control applications to inspect small parts, electronics and materials for defects or damage.

10 Can Microscope Camera be used for cell culture analysis?

It is commonly used for cell culture analysis in biological research to monitor cell growth and behavior.
